All are considered laboratory-developed tests, and are for that reason not controlled by the Fda. ad Yet doctor groups have for years advised versus utilizing immunoglobulin G tests to examine for so-called food level of sensitivities or intolerances. And allergy experts told STAT that the test is ineffective at finest and could even cause damage if it leads customers to needlessly cut nutritious foods from their diet plan.

Food sensitivity is an umbrella term that encompasses signs that can arise, for example, from difficulty absorbing a food, as in lactose intolerance, or vulnerability to the effect of a food, as in caffeine sensitivity. These signs, nevertheless, do not include an immune reaction. (Food allergic reactions, on the other hand, have more serious symptoms and are driven by the body immune system; validated tests for them do exist.) Patients who ask Dr.

Dr. Martha Hartz, a specialist at Mayo Clinic in Rochester, Minn., says she often evaluates clients who have actually currently dished out the cash for the screening. "Anytime I see a client who's had these sort of tests, we get them to toss it aside," Hartz stated.

It is simply not a test that ought to done." Everly, Well's food level of sensitivity test utilizes a blood sample to search for immune system activity. Everly, Well's food level of sensitivity tests exploit an aggravating truth for those wondering whether their symptoms stem from the food they eat: There is no easy method to find an answer. The doctor-advised technique is to cut typical transgressors from the diet plan one by one a so-called elimination diet but that is troublesome, lengthy, and, by its very nature, limiting.

Your body can react to a "frustrating" food in a number of different ways, and how your body responds to that food depends upon whether you have a food sensitivity, food intolerance, or food allergic reaction. It's not unusual for confusion to exist around the fact that allergic reactions, intolerances, and sensitivities aren't interchangeable.

Food Level of sensitivity A food sensitivity might result from a kind of immune system response that's very various than a food allergy. While not totally understood, research has actually revealed that individuals might identify symptom-causing foods using the outcomes of Ig, G testing along with an elimination diet plan. Ig, G antibody responses versus those foods might be typical in some people, however in others it might cause signs since of the inflammation the immune response produces from those interactions.

What's actually intriguing about food level of sensitivities is that signs usually do not look like quickly as you consume the issue food. Rather, you may have symptoms hours or days after eating that food which can make it difficult to connect specific foods to the signs you're experiencing. With a removal diet plan and Everly, Well's Food Level of sensitivity Test, you can discover what foods you may be delicate to.

Unlike food allergies, food intolerances don't include an immune system response - they all occur inside the gut prior to digestion occurs.

If the absence of clinical backing is not sufficient to persuade you to go to a professional rather, the fact that there is no backing likewise suggests that taking an at-home food sensitivity test will just prove an inconvenience. As Excellent, RX Health notes, you will need to spend for a test and after that in all probability, have to take a test when you visit the expert anyway - everlywell logo png.

Nevertheless, as the certified diet professional Tamara Duker Freuman wrote in a piece for Self, a specialist would rather you not take a test prior to seeing them. That's since they have to dispel any notions that the test had offered the client. The best case scenarios are those in which the client listens.
